Historical Evolution of Jigsaw Puzzles

From Wood to Cardboard
The origin of jigsaw puzzles dates back to the 18th century, when British cartographer, John Spilsbury, devised a new way to teach geography. He glued maps onto wooden boards and cut them into pieces using a saw to create the first puzzles. These early puzzles became popular among affluent households, including the British Royal family 1.
As time went on, jigsaw puzzles began to shift from wooden materials to more affordable alternatives like cardboard. The use of popular pictures in puzzles emerged in the 1860s and 70s, in both Great Britain and the United States2. The affordability of cardboard puzzles contributed to a massive surge in their popularity during the Great Depression of the 1930s, providing inexpensive and reusable entertainment. This popularity continued, and another revival of jigsaw puzzles began after World War II2.
Modern jigsaw puzzles have evolved in their complexity and materials. Cardboard remains a popular choice, but manufacturers have started incorporating recycled materials to promote sustainability3. The quality of puzzles varies depending on the brand, with some focusing on intricate, artistic designs while others prioritize accessible and family-friendly themes4.
To sum up, the historical evolution of jigsaw puzzles has seen transitions from wood to cardboard, growth in popularity, and adaptations to meet modern demands for quality and sustainability.

Top Jigsaw Puzzle Brands

Ravensburger
Ravensburger, a German-based company, is known for its high-quality and innovative jigsaw puzzles. They offer a wide range of puzzle themes and sizes, catering to various skill levels and preferences. Ravensburger puzzles are known for their precision-cut pieces made from premium quality materials, ensuring a perfect fit.
Some popular Ravensburger puzzle series include:
- 3D Puzzles: These puzzles create impressive three-dimensional structures, such as landmarks and famous buildings.
- Disney Collection: Featuring beloved Disney characters and scenes, these puzzles are perfect for fans of all ages.
Buffalo Games
Buffalo Games is a popular American jigsaw puzzle brand that offers a diverse range of themes and sizes. They emphasize quality and use a unique puzzle cutting process that guarantees a seamless fit.
Some standout features of Buffalo Games puzzles include:
- Custom Artwork: Many puzzles feature exclusive artwork by top illustrators and photographers.
- Poster Included: A reference poster is included for a more enjoyable puzzling experience.
Eurographics
Eurographics is another top-tier jigsaw puzzle brand, known for its stunning imagery and superior quality materials. They offer puzzles with intricate designs and feature various themes such as fine art, landscapes, and more.
Notable attributes of Eurographics puzzles:
- Eco-friendly: They use recyclable, vegetable-based materials and ensure minimal environmental impact during production.
- Smart Cut Technology: Unique puzzle piece shapes are created for a more engaging and challenging experience.

Unique Piece Counts and Shapes
Jigsaw puzzles offer various levels of challenge through different piece counts and unique puzzle piece shapes. Typically, puzzles range from:
- Easy: 300 to 500 pieces
- Medium: 500 to 1,000 pieces
- Hard: 1,000 to 2,000 pieces
Higher piece counts usually result in a more challenging puzzle experience. However, unique puzzle piece shapes also contribute to the level of difficulty. For instance, Cobble Hill provides puzzles with randomly cut pieces, increasing the complexity of the puzzle-solving process.
In addition to the standard piece count options, some brands produce puzzles with an unconventional number of pieces, such as 2,000-piece versions of EuroGraphics’ depiction of Monet’s The Artist’s Garden. This level of customization allows puzzle enthusiasts to select puzzles that closely match their preferred challenge level, while still enjoying a visually compelling puzzle experience.

Are there any luxury jigsaw puzzles that are considered the most expensive?
Luxury jigsaw puzzles from brands like Stave, Wentworth, and Liberty Puzzles are considered some of the most expensive. These high-end puzzles typically feature hand-cut wooden pieces, intricate designs, and personalized customization options, making them highly sought after by collectors and enthusiasts alike.
